  • Publication number: 20220294539
    Abstract: An underwater optical communication device communicates with another underwater optical communication device. The underwater optical communication device is provided with an optical transmitter, an optical receiver, and a controller. The optical transmitter transmits laser light to another underwater optical communication device. The optical receiver receives laser light from another underwater optical communication device. The controller controls the optical transmitter and the optical receiver. The optical receiver is provided with a polarizing plate configured to transmit S-polarized light of natural light and suppress transmission of P-polarized light of natural light and a photodetector configured to detect laser light emitted from the polarizing plate.

  • Publication number: 20220099952
    Abstract: A light receiving device of optical communication equipment includes a condenser lens configured to condense incident light, a collimation lens having a focal length shorter than a focal length of the condenser lens, the collimation lens being configured to convert light from the condenser lens to parallel light, a bandpass filter having a filter surface on which the parallel light from the collimation lens is perpendicularly incident, the bandpass filter being configured to transmit only a wavelength of the incident light, and a light receiving element configured to detect light transmitted through the bandpass filter.

  • Patent number: 10591657
    Abstract: An optical fiber laser module is provided with an optical fiber (2) for diffusing light, and a laser module housing (1) connected to the optical fiber. The laser module housing is provided with a laser light source (11) that outputs laser light to the optical fiber, and a light detector (14) that detects laser light that has been wave-guided through the full length of the optical fiber. The optical fiber is provided with: a light incident part (3a) provided inside the laser module housing, laser light from the laser light source being incident on the light incident part; and a terminal part (3) on which is formed a reflective film (4) that reflects the laser light that was incident on the light incident part and was wave-guided through the full length of the optical fiber so as to return the laser light to the light incident part.
